What does it mean to be an IB Primary years educator? An IB education supports the development of learners through a holistic approach within its inquiry-based and contextualised curriculum frameworks. In this workshop, participants will explore how:
- An IB education develops agentic lifelong learners who are internationally-minded and demonstrate attributes of the IB learner profile
- Approaches to teaching and learning help students develop the attitudes and skills they need for both academic and personal success
- An inquiry-based learning environment develops students’ curiosity and deeper understanding of concepts, contexts and conceptual understandings.
Collaborating as a community of learners impacts learning and teaching and the success of every learner
